Bakers Salary in Georgia
BLS OEWS May 2025 • 17 metro areas • Georgia
Bakers in Georgia earn a median salary of $30,416 per year on average across 17 metro and nonmetro areas, -17% vs the national median of $36,650. An estimated 7,360 bakers are employed across Georgia, with salaries ranging from $28,100 to $36,190 depending on location.

Bakers salaries by city in Georgia
| Metro area | Median salary | 25th pct | 75th pct | Employed |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Rome, GA | $36,190 | $30,050 | $52,490 | 80 |
| Atlanta, GA | $33,880 | $25,100 | $37,750 | 5,220 |
| Gainesville, GA | $33,860 | $23,500 | $42,260 | 130 |
| Savannah, GA | $33,500 | $25,310 | $36,440 | 320 |
| Warner Robins, GA | $30,460 | $23,610 | $36,830 | 70 |
| Brunswick, GA | $30,240 | $22,260 | $37,380 | 50 |
| Macon, GA | $30,030 | $24,860 | $34,410 | 90 |
| East Georgia | $29,740 | $22,080 | $34,360 | 70 |
| Columbus, GA-AL | $29,660 | $22,410 | $35,780 | 170 |
| Dalton, GA | $29,630 | $24,240 | $34,170 | 30 |
| Valdosta, GA | $29,370 | $21,580 | $33,770 | 120 |
| Athens, GA | $28,730 | $21,990 | $32,280 | 160 |
| Augusta, GA-SC | $28,620 | $21,090 | $34,980 | 340 |
| South Georgia | $28,490 | $23,860 | $35,500 | 160 |
| Albany, GA | $28,420 | $21,540 | $33,830 | 60 |
| North Georgia | $28,160 | $24,730 | $34,360 | 190 |
| Middle Georgia | $28,100 | $23,870 | $34,360 | 100 |
